Plymouth Highbury Trust was established in 1956 with 30 members, parents of children with a Learning Disability and was set up as Plymouth Mencap Society. Over the last 66 years they became registered as a Charity in 1967; purchased their existing premises on Outland Road, Plymouth from the Local authority in 1976; Became a Company Limited by Guarantee and underwent a change of name to Plymouth Highbury Trust in 2005; The Trust and its subsidiary now employs around 70 full and part time staff and recruits, trains and supports over 30 volunteers and supports over 650 adults with a learning disability plus their families/carers.
